Lydia Dyer 1772–1849 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 11 MAY 1772

Birth Location: North Kingstown, Washington, Rhode Island, USA

Death Date: 11 MAY 1849

Death Location: Shaftsbury, Bennington, Vermont, USA

Father: Corp Dyer

Mother: Bathsheba Dunn

Spouse(s): David Millington

Children(s): Norman Millington

Lydia Dyer was born in 1772 in North Kingstown, Washington, Rhode Island, USA, the child of Corp John Dyer And Bathsheba C Dyer Dunn. Lydia Dyer married David Millington, and had children including Norman Millington. Lydia Dyer passed away in 1849 in Shaftsbury, Bennington, Vermont, USA.
